I don't care if you are a fake poster. It's not hard to get me talking about anything outdoorsy. We're coming into my favorite time of year... I threw a few Sluggo's at the local smallmouth contingent yesterday in the Little J. I bagged a 15-incher on my first cast, and subsequently banked 3 more in short order. I had my kayak with me, but it got too windy shortly thereafter. I hate fishing/kayaking in the wind, I'd rather fish in an all-day downpour. Kayaks are light and don't displace much water, so they blow around whatever way the wind is blowing. I've literally spun in circles all day long, and it's very frustrating.
Anyway, late May-early June is what I live for. The bass almost jump in the boat. You can't keep 'em, but I seldom do that anyway.--->JMS
